Australia Day 2016: Celebrate safely, cops implore
WAGGA police have implored locals to celebrate safely this Australia Day, as the increase of alcohol and drugs pose a growing danger. Inspector Peter Robertson urged merry-makers to drink responsibly and warned an increased police presence would be on duty across the city. Significant fines apply to trouble-makers. A person faces a $550 fine if they fail to leave a licensed premise, another $550 if they return and a further $500 for anti-social behaviour. Double demerits will also be enforced for traffic offences.
